Returning in full amount to field is the key way to realize recycling of crop straws.However,considerable change of effective nitrogen supply dynamic occurs in the soil with all crop straw returning,which may affect crop yield and nitrogen efficiency.In this study,the effects of nitrogen management on yield and nitrogen utilization in double cropping rice system with full rice straw returning were investigated to formulate nitrogen application strategy for early and late rice.The results showed that,under full returning of rice straw,recommended N (RN) treatments reduced grain yield of early rice due to the decline in number of spikelets per panicle and 1000-grain-weight,but yield difference between RN and FN treatment was not significant.Meanwhile,grain yield of late rice with RN treatments was more stable than that of early rice with the same treatments.RN combined with higher topdressing ratio,namely RN4∶6 in this experiment improved nitrogen accumulation by rice plant and elevated nitrogen recovery in both early and late rice.These effects were more apparent when microbial inoculant was used.In conclusion,with full returning of rice straw,moderate nitrogen fertilizer reduction and higher topdressing ratio can improve nitrogen uptake by rice plant and nitrogen recovery without significant yield loss in double rice cropping system.Microbial inoculant may help to stabilize rice yield.
